I have 4 factory mags, along with 3 of the steel lip 25 round BCreek mags (black as well as clear) & a 10 shot BCreek CLEAR steel lip mag. They all function properly, however all of the 25 round mags. screwed up with the first few mag fulls of ammo - then stopped screwing up. Make sure the bottom of the mag is not contacting the bench top surface.

I really like the 25 rounders when shooting gophers. With 2 mags stuck together, a quick reload gives 50 rounds capacity, with another 75 rounds in the cargo-pant's pockets with 5 10 rounders and the other 25.

I should add that my only jamming problems come from powder fouling buildup inside the action - mostly along the top inside surface. I use spray- WD40, or powder solvent and a tooth brush to loosen it - wipe it out, then go back to shooting.
